Bangladesh: High construction cost to double power generation cost

DHAKA, 18 July 2022, (TON): The cost of per kilowatt power production from Rooppur Nuclear Power Plant in Bangladesh will be 9.36 cents compared to 5.34 cents from a similar plant in Tamil Nadu’s Kudankulam, India.

The high construction cost of Rooppur Nuclear Power Plant is said to be the reason behind the excessive cost of would-be power production.   

According to a research released by Springer-Verlag GmbH, Germany “in Bangladeshi currency, the production cost of per unit electricity from two reactors of the RNPP will be Tk 7.94 while their establishment costs are $12.65 billion.”

In Indian currency, the production cost of power from Kudankulam 3 and 4 plants will be Rupee 3.93 since their construction costs are about $5.38 billion.
